Sinks Canyon is one of the many state parks in Wyoming overshadowed by Yellowstone, while offering its own incredible adventures. Located 7 miles south of the city of Lander, near the Wind River ...
and pine forests await tourists who decide to visit Sinks Canyon State Park in Wyoming. Tourists might wonder what the name ...